Fridge Standard Size Specifications. The size of your budget, family and kitchen will dictate what size fridge you choose. Here’s the standard refrigerator size—and when to go bigger. Standard refrigerator sizes typically range in width from 65cm to 100cm, height from 150cm to 190cm, and depth from 65cm to. Each adult requires 4 to 6 cubic feet of refrigerator space for groceries.
